Best WordPress plugins for course progress tracking can make a world of difference when it comes to keeping your students engaged and motivated. Whether you’re running an online school, offering coaching programs, or selling digital courses, knowing how far your learners have come—and where they’re headed—is key to creating a great learning experience. Without a clear way to track progress, students can easily feel lost or disconnected.
What Makes a Course Progress Plugin Worth Using?
Not all progress trackers are created equal. The best plugins do more than just show a bar that slowly fills up. They provide interactive dashboards, track lesson and quiz completion, and offer motivational elements like badges or certificates. More importantly, they integrate seamlessly with popular LMS platforms like LearnDash, Tutor LMS, and LifterLMS. When done right, progress tracking isn’t just a feature—it’s a tool that enhances user experience and encourages students to finish what they started.
Why Plugins Beat Manual Tracking Every Time
You might wonder why you need a plugin at all. Couldn’t you just track student progress manually or use simple spreadsheets? The short answer: you could, but you really shouldn’t. Manual tracking is time-consuming, error-prone, and doesn’t scale well. Plugins take the guesswork out of the equation. They automate progress calculation, generate detailed reports, and allow you to focus on improving your content, not crunching numbers. For a polished and scalable experience, using one of the 12 best WordPress plugins for course progress tracking is simply the smart move.
How We Choose the Best Plugins for This List
To make this list genuinely useful, we applied strict criteria. Each plugin was evaluated based on features, usability, pricing, customer reviews, and compatibility with major LMS platforms. We also looked at plugin update frequency, developer support, and how well each one supports engagement tools like quizzes, assignments, and certificates. The final list offers a diverse range—from full LMS platforms to specialized add-ons—so you’ll find something that fits your unique course setup.
Top 12 WordPress Plugins for Course Progress Tracking That Every Educator Should Know
Tracking student progress is essential for fostering engagement and ensuring course completion. In this post, we’ll dive into the top 12 WordPress plugins for course progress tracking, providing you with the tools you need to improve your learners’ experience and increase retention.
1. LearnDash
LearnDash easily earns its place among the 12 best WordPress plugins for course progress tracking because it’s built for serious course creators. It comes with built-in progress indicators, lesson timers, quizzes, and automated email reminders to re-engage learners. The plugin’s dynamic course progression ensures that students move through content in a structured way. It even supports advanced analytics, so you can track exactly where students succeed—or get stuck.
2. Tutor LMS
Tutor LMS offers a sleek, beginner-friendly design with powerful course tracking features. It shows learners exactly how far they’ve progressed within a course and includes completion certificates and built-in quiz modules. Its customizable student dashboard gives users a clear view of their learning path. Among the 12 best WordPress plugins for course progress tracking, Tutor LMS stands out for its modern UI and strong free version.
Also Read: 12 Best WordPress Plugins for Multi-User Websites
3. LifterLMS
LifterLMS is more than just a course plugin—it’s a full learning business toolkit. When it comes to tracking course progress, it offers visual progress indicators, lesson locking, and completion certificates. It also lets you gamify learning with achievement badges and personalized learning paths. As one of the 12 best WordPress plugins for course progress tracking, LifterLMS is ideal for coaches, educators, and membership site owners alike.
4. GamiPress
GamiPress helps turn your course site into a gamified learning experience. It tracks user progress through points, levels, and achievements. You can set custom triggers like “complete 3 lessons” or “score above 80% on a quiz” to reward learners. If you want to make progress tracking more engaging, GamiPress is one of the smartest additions to the 12 best WordPress plugins for course progress tracking.
5. MemberPress Courses
If you want to monetize access to your courses while tracking learner activity, MemberPress Courses is a great choice. It offers progress tracking tied to membership levels, so you can drip content based on how far users have come. It’s simple to set up and works great for ongoing training programs, making it a strategic addition to the 12 best WordPress plugins for course progress tracking.
6. LearnPress
LearnPress is a free LMS plugin that still packs plenty of punch. It allows you to set up complete course structures with quizzes and assignments, while tracking completion as students progress. It’s ideal for creators looking for budget-friendly options. For those just getting started, LearnPress deserves its place on the list of 12 best WordPress plugins for course progress tracking.
7. Sensei LMS
Created by the team behind WooCommerce, Sensei LMS brings seamless eCommerce integration along with a clean learning experience. It features built-in progress tracking, quiz analytics, and course grading. For those already using WooCommerce, this plugin provides a no-fuss way to deliver and monitor learning—earning it a clear spot among the 12 best WordPress plugins for course progress tracking.
8. MemberPress Courses
If you want to monetize access to your courses while tracking learner activity, MemberPress Courses is a great choice. It offers progress tracking tied to membership levels, so you can drip content based on how far users have come. It’s simple to set up and works great for ongoing training programs, making it a strategic addition to the 12 best WordPress plugins for course progress tracking.
Also Read: 12 Best WordPress Plugins for Gamification
9. H5P
H5P isn’t a full LMS plugin, but it’s a powerful add-on for interactive content and learner engagement. It supports tracking of interactive quizzes, video-based questions, and presentations. Combined with other LMS platforms, H5P adds a dynamic dimension to progress tracking and boosts learner retention. That’s why it earns its place among the 12 best WordPress plugins for course progress tracking.
10. WP Courseware
WP Courseware is another solid choice for those who want an intuitive drag-and-drop course builder with built-in tracking tools. This plugin monitors student progression through each module, keeps tabs on quiz performance, and even emails students when they fall behind. If you’re after simplicity without sacrificing functionality, WP Courseware is a top contender among the 12 best WordPress plugins for course progress tracking.
11. BadgeOS
BadgeOS is a flexible plugin that tracks learning milestones and rewards users with digital badges. These badges can be tied to specific course activities, encouraging learners to stay the course. With full support for LearnDash and other LMS plugins, BadgeOS is a fun, goal-oriented way to make progress tracking feel less like work—and more like a game. It rightly belongs on the list of the 12 best WordPress plugins for course progress tracking.
12. Progress Bar for LearnDash
Progress Bar for LearnDash is a simple but effective add-on for course creators using the LearnDash platform. It lets you add fully customizable progress bars to lesson and topic pages, helping learners visually track their advancement. While it’s not a standalone LMS, it enhances the user experience so well that it earns a spot on our curated list of the 12 best WordPress plugins for course progress tracking.
Tracking Progress Is the Key to Learning Success
Choosing the right plugin is one of the most powerful decisions you’ll make as a course creator. With the help of one of the 12 best WordPress plugins for course progress tracking, you can deliver a better learning experience, build trust with your students, and improve completion rates. Whether you’re running a single course or building an entire eLearning platform, tracking student progress is a must. Take the time to explore these plugins, test a few out, and choose one that matches your course goals. Ready to make learning more engaging and effective? Start tracking, and let the progress speak for itself.
Interesting Reads:
12 Best WordPress Plugins for Online Courses